Would you mind sharing your 13 month old's routine please. E.g milk, meals, naps and night sleep?

My 13mo gets up between half 6 and 7 and has milk straight away. Then breakfast about half an hour later. If he's at home dinner tends to be around half 12 and tea is always at 6. Different on nursery days. He naps about 3 hours after getting up for anywhere between 30 mins and 1hr30. Another nap about 3 and a half hours later. Bath at 7 followed by milk, story and bed.
Don't know of it's the right thing to be doing but seems to work for us at the moment although I think he'll go down to one nap soon.

6.30am Wake up
7am Breakfast and cup of milk
11.30am lunch
12pm 2 hour nap
4.30pm Dinner
6pm Bath & stories
6.30/6.45pm Milk & Bed

5.30am (booo)- milk, back into cot
6.30am up for the day
8am- breakfast
10.30-11.30 nap
12-12.30- lunch
2.45-snack
3-4 nap
5.30- dinner
6.30- bath, followed by bottle downstairs then teeth
7pm- bed

He's 14 months and in the last two weeks or so he's had a few days where either we've done a morning toddler group or he's just not wanted a morning nap so has has a 2 hour one at 12.30. I think he'll probably switch to one nap then in the coming months.
